本研究旨在通过研究不同水平苏丹蜂胶等非传统天然添加剂对日本鹌鹑生产性能、生理参数和氧化状态的影响,探讨其作为潜在替代品的可行性。选取480只7日龄无性日本鹌鹑,随机分为4组;每次治疗包含120只鸟。在鹌鹑7 ~ 42日龄期间,4个等量组分别根据蜂胶添加量进行4种饲粮处理:T1:对照组(基础饲粮中不添加蜂胶)。T2:基础饲粮+ 250 mg蜂胶/kg饲粮。T3:基础饲粮+ 500 mg蜂胶/kg饲粮。T4:基础饲粮+蜂胶750 mg /kg饲粮。结果表明,添加750和500 mg蜂胶组42日龄体重显著高于对照组和250 mg组(p=0.0020)。与对照组相比,饲粮添加500和750 mg/kg蜂胶组鹌鹑生长期增重显著提高了5%和8% (p=0.0035)。添加3个水平的蜂胶可显著提高饲料系数(p=0.0239),分别比对照组提高了3、7.5和11%。与对照组相比,三种蜂胶水平均显著提高了红细胞、血红蛋白和红细胞压积值。与对照组相比,三种蜂胶水平均显著降低了总脂、胆固醇、甘油三酯和低密度脂蛋白。同时,与对照组相比,三种蜂胶水平的HDL显著升高。此外,与对照组相比,3个水平蜂胶均显著提高了IgM、淋巴细胞、球蛋白和总抗氧化能力。由此可见,添加蜂胶能显著提高鹌鹑的生产性能和抗氧化能力。

SOME PRODUCTIVE AND PHYSIOLOGICAL RESPONSES OF GROWING JAPANESE QUAILS TO SUDANESE PROPOLIS ADDITION
: The current study was performed aiming to investigate the untraditional natural additives such as different levels of Sudanese propolis as prospective alternatives through studying their effect on productive performance, physiological parameters and oxidative status of Japanese quails. A total number of 480 unsexed Japanese quails at 7days of age were randomly distributed for four equal treatments; every treatment contains120 birds for each treatment. Four equal treatments were received four dietary treatments depending on addition of Propolis levels from 7 days to 42 days of quails age as follows: T1: Control (basal diet without Propolis addition). T2: basal diet + 250 mg Propolis /kg diet. T3: basal diet + 500 mg Propolis /kg diet. T4: basal diet + 750 mg Propolis /kg diet. Results showed that body weight at 42 days was heavier significantly (p=0.0020) with 750 and 500 mg propolis addition treatments than control and 250 mg treatments. The same trend found in body weight gain during growing period of quails, which increased significantly (p=0.0035) by 5 and 8% with 500 and 750 mg/kg diet Propolis addition than control, respectively. Moreover, feed conversion ratio was improved significantly (p=0.0239) by 3, 7.5 and 11% compared to control with the three levels of Propolis, respectively. Red blood cells, hemoglobin and hematocrit values were significantly increased with the three levels of Propolis compared to control. Total lipids, cholesterol, triglycerides and LDL were significantly decreased with the three levels of Propolis compared to control. While, HDL was significantly increased with the three levels of Propolis compared to control. Furthermore, IgM, lymphocytes, globulin and total antioxidant capacity were significantly increased with the three levels of Propolis compared to control. From these results we can concluded that, addition of Propolis caused significant improvements in quails’ productive performance and anti-oxidative status.
